Key Terms and Legal Glossary

Familiarizing yourself with common legal terms can help you better understand your case and the judicial proceedings.

Arraignment

The initial court appearance where charges are formally presented, and the defendant enters a plea.

Plea Bargain

An agreement between defendant and prosecutor to resolve the case without trial, often involving reduced charges or sentencing.

Discovery

The pre-trial process where both sides exchange evidence and information relevant to the case.

Trial

A formal court proceeding where evidence is presented, and a judge or jury determines guilt or innocence.

What should I do if I am accused of child molestation?

If you are accused of child molestation, it is critical to seek legal advice immediately. Avoid discussing the case with others and do not provide statements to authorities without an attorney present. Early legal intervention helps protect your rights and can influence the direction of your case. An experienced lawyer will guide you through the process, explain your options, and work to defend your interests.

Penalties for child molestation convictions in California can be severe, including imprisonment, fines, mandatory registration as a sex offender, and probation. The severity depends on factors such as the nature of the offense, prior criminal history, and victim age. Understanding potential penalties helps in preparing an effective defense strategy.

The duration of a child molestation case varies based on case complexity, court schedules, and whether the case resolves through plea negotiations or goes to trial. Some cases may conclude within a few months, while others can take over a year. Your attorney will keep you informed about timelines and progress.
